specification
noun
    1a. A detailed description of the type of methods, materials, dimensions, quantities, etc that are used in the construction, manufacture, building, planning, etc of something;
      Thesaurus: term, condition, requirement, stipulation.
      Form: specifications (often)
    1b. The standard, quality, etc of the construction, manufacture, etc of something.
      Example: Saabs are built to high safety specifications
    2. An act or instance or the process of specifying.
    3. A document that details the particulars and projected use of an invention and which the person wanting to patent it draws up before submitting it to the proper authorities.
Etymology: 17c: from specify.
